Sale Won't Affect Bonnie Castle Plans

Published: February 28, 2012 01:33 pm EST

It has been reported that there is an impending sale for the Bonnie Castle Manor and Marina in upstate New York, but any sale, if it is to happen, should not affect the racino proposal

, according to a report.

The news comes courtesy of an article by the Watertown Daily Times, which has quoted co-owner Marc Fernandez as saying that his father-in-law, co-owner Donald Cole, is “getting really close” to making the $140-million expansion a reality.

The expansion project, if it comes to fruition, would see an 'upscale racino' with a harness-racing track, a 30,000-square-foot casino and a 125-room hotel be built beside the recreation centre, which is located off of Route 12 in Alexandria Bay, New York, which is just minutes from the Ontario/New York border and a mere 15 kilometers from Ontario's Highway 401.
